Symptom Analysis in Substance Use

A college student is brought to the campus health center by their roommate. The roommate reports that the student has been complaining of a constantly racing heart and nausea for the past few days. The student also seems unusually agitated and has expressed intense, unfounded fears that their professors are plotting to fail them. Based on this specific combination of physical and psychological symptoms, which category of psychoactive substance is most likely responsible? Explain your reasoning by linking the reported symptoms to the known effects of that substance category.
